Foundation, SHEDI donate classrooms to Abuja public school
The School Hunters Education Development Initiative (SHEDI) in partnership with TY Danjuma Foundation has donated a block of five classrooms, learning materials and furniture to LEA Primary School, Dakwo, Abuja.
Speaking at the handover ceremony in Abuja, the Group Managing Director of SHEDI, Shola Okpodu, said the rationale behind the intervention, which was funded by TY Danjuma Foundation, was to improve the standard of education at the grassroots.
She said the intervention would improve the standard of early child care education in the school, adding that the pupils of the school would graduate into the primary section now better built.

She noted that aside building classrooms they also provided the school with learning facilities which included three desktop computers, six tables and chairs, and repaired 100 tables and chairs.
Responding, the headmistress the school, Mrs. Aisha Ahmed, commended the groups for coming to the rescue of the school.
